Established in April 2012, the ESO Network is a podcast network of shows that celebrate a love for pop culture, sci-fi, comics, and all things geek.



Join podcasts like Earth Station One, Earth Station Who, Earth Station DCU, The Blurred Nerds, The FlopCast, The Dragon Con Report, The 42cast, and so much more. We dive headfirst into the world of our favorite topics, get into trouble, and find our way out again! Stop by for a listen and let your inner geek out to play.

    War Of The Satellites } Episode 417

    War Of The Satellites } Episode 417

    Jim reminices about the second “Monster Movie” he ever saw – Roger Corman’s 1958 Sci-Fi “War Of The Satellites,” starring Dick Miller, Susan Cabot, Richard Devon, Eric Sinclair, Michael Fox, Robert Shayne, Jared Barclay, and John Brinkley. The story centers around man’s ttempt to explore space while an alien race tries to prevent them from leaving planet Earth. Find out more on this episode of MONSTER ATTACK!, The Podcast Dedicated To Old Monster Movies.

    Modern Musicology #116 – 1984 Part 1: Hard Rock & Metal

    Modern Musicology #116 – 1984 Part 1: Hard Rock & Metal

    1984 was an incredible year for music, and it was a particularly strong year for hard rock and metal. We’re joined by guests Courtland Lewis and Matt Alschbach of the Rock and Metal Profs Podcast for a great discussion of what factors made 1984 such a highwater mark for the genre, and we review some of our favorite releases of the year. We spotlight albums by Van Halen, KISS, Dio, Iron Maiden, Deep Purple, Queenryche, Ratt, Metallica, Dokken, Scorpions, plus a whole lot more. And of course no discussion of the metal releases of 1984 would be complete without a mention of the soundtrack to the classic film This is Spinal Tap!

    The Epsilon Three Episode 128 – Each Night I Dream of Home

    The Epsilon Three Episode 128 – Each Night I Dream of Home

    The Epsilon Three bring you their review of the Babylon 5: Crusade Episode: Each Night I Dream of Home.







    A Warlock-class destroyer drops off two passengers onto Excalibur with instructions to take them to Earth. On the way, the crew take a risk by stopping to rescue a Starfury and Elizabeth Lochley. On arrival at Earth, they are greeted from a lifepod isolated in the medbay by Doctor Stephen Franklin.
